Shawnee, Kansas

Shawnee, Kansas, in Johnson county, is 4 miles NW of Overland Park, Kansas (center to center) and 8 miles SW of Kansas City, Missouri. The city is conveniently located inside the Kansas City metropolitan area. There are an estimated 47,996 people in Shawnee.

The People and Families of Shawnee

In Shawnee, about 64% of adults are married.

Wealth and Education

In 2000, Shawnee had a median family income of $70,288. Shawnee has more than its share of wealthy families and people. The city has a large middle class. You won't find a lot of people in Shawnee living below the poverty line. It's worth mentioning that smart, educated people feel at home in the city.

Political Inclinations

In the 2004 race for President, George W. Bush was the top recipient of campaign contributions ($28,047) in Shawnee. Party contributions tended to flow to the Republican team.

Shawnee Housing

Approximately 74% of housing in Shawnee is owner-occupied. The city contains many homes that have been built in recent years. Property taxes are a bit high in Shawnee, which may indicate the community's investment in its schools and infrastructure.

Commuting

In Shawnee, 95% of commuters drive to work. There just aren't a lot of public transporation users in the city.

The two main aspects of addiction, physical and psychological, are what the individual will be addressing during the course of treatment at a Drug Rehab or Alcohol Treatment Facility in Shawnee. Individuals will first begin by addressing the aspect of physical addiction by taking part in a detoxification program in Shawnee, Kansas, which will help with the u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ms that ensue when a person stops using drugs or alcohol. The brain adapts to the use of a psychoactive substance over time, which lessens the effect of the drug. This is how physical tolerance to drugs such as heroin, amphetamines, cocaine, nicotine and alcohol develops. This is why someone using drugs has to take more and more of the substance to get the same effect. Abruptly stopping substance use is what causes the u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ms. These symptoms could last for days, weeks or even months depending on the individual's history of abuse. Hardcore drugs such as heroin have a particularly long and painful withdrawal period.

Interesting Facts and Statistics:

Both new and experienced heroin users risk overdosing on heroin because it is impossible for them to know the purity of the heroin they are using.

Current employment status is also highly correlated with rates of illegal drug use. An estimated 17.1 percent of unemployed adults aged 18 or older were current illegal drug users in 2001 compared with 6.9 percent of those employed full time and 9.1 percent of those employed part time.

In 2005, adults with MDE in the past year were more likely than those without MDE to have used an illegal drug in the past year (26.8 vs. 12.7 percent). A similar pattern was observed for specific types of past year illegal drug use, such as marijuana, cocaine, heroin, hallucinogens, inhalants, and the nonmedical use of prescription-type psychotherapeutics.

This category includes nonmedical use of any prescription-type pain reliever, tranquilizer, stimulant, or sedative; it also includes methamphetamines. This category does not include over-the-counter substances.

According to the most recent studies that were conducted by the Drug Abuse Warning Network (DAWN), fourteen of the top twenty most abused controlled substances in the United States, are reported to be prescription drugs. Benzodiazepines, such as Xanax rank highest on the list, and are closely followed by the opiates or painkillers.

Symptoms of withdrawal for long-term marijuana users begin within about 1 day following abstinence, peak at 2-3 days, and subside within 1 or 2 weeks following drug cessation.
